Access Your Amazon Past Purchases: A Simple Guide

What are Amazon Past Purchases?

Amazon past purchases are a list of products you've bought on the platform. You can access this list to reorder items, keep track of your spending, or simply see what you've purchased in the past.

To access your Amazon past purchases, follow these simple steps:

  • Login to your Amazon account.
  • Go to your account settings.
  • Click on 'Order history' or 'Purchased items'.

Alternatively, you can use the Amazon app on your mobile device to access your past purchases. Simply open the app, log in to your account, and navigate to the 'Order history' or 'Purchased items' section.
